Infusing AI into Education: Challenges and Opportunities

Integrating artificial intelligence into the educational landscape presents a wealth of opportunities, but also poses considerable challenges. On one hand, AI can tailor learning experiences, delivering students with targeted support. Moreover, AI-powered tools can automate administrative tasks, freeing up educators to devote on AI in teaching and learning more meaningful interactions with their learners. However, concerns remain about the potential of AI prejudice in educational algorithms and the need for ongoing teacher training to effectively utilize these technologies. Addressing these challenges will be crucial for harnessing the full potential of AI in education.
